How to Make Strawberry Cake

Making strawberry cake is simple. Just follow these steps to create a lovely cake that everyone will enjoy.

Ingredients:

  • 12 large eggs
  • 600 g sugar
  • 1 tbsp vanilla essence
  • 400 ml whole milk
  • 400 ml vegetable oil (or melted butter)
  • 900 g whole wheat flour
  • 30 g baking powder
  • 1 pinch of salt

Directions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F). Grease and flour a 35 x 45 cm cake pan.
  2. In a large bowl, beat the eggs and sugar together until light and fluffy.
  3. Add the vanilla essence, milk, and vegetable oil (or melted butter), and mix well.
  4. In another bowl, sift together the whole wheat flour, baking powder, and salt.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ined.
  6.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top.
  7.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  8. Let the cake c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

How to Store Strawberry Cake

If you have leftover cake, you can store it easily. Keep the cake covered at room temperature for 2-3 days. For longer storage, wrap it in plastic wrap and place it in the refrigerator. It can last up to a week in the fridge.

Tips to Make Strawberry Cake

  • Make sure your eggs are at room temperature for better mixing.
  • Do not overmix the batter; mix just until combined to keep the cake fluffy.
  • You can add a layer of strawberry jam between the cake layers for extra flavor.
